Overview"When you are young and invincible there is no downside to learning to ride a horse. When you are over sixty and decide to learn, well now, that takes you out a whole new door. Yeah Baby. Come along on a quick ride with me as I humorously share some of my adventures, memories, challenges, and accomplishments during the first nine years of my journey into horsemanship. See the world through an old man's eyes as I learn how to ride, survive, and try to understand the challenging world of horses literally from the ground up. Even if you have never ridden a horse in your life, you will enjoy riding along with this ""Unbalanced Ca'boy"" as I recount some of my many adventures. Laugh with me as I share with you some of the parts of horsemanship, I had no clue existed. This trail ride starts with my wife's dream of owning horses coming to fruition, and how I slowly become more and more involved in that dream. It humorously follows the evolution of events as I begin to learn, understand, and appreciate all that is involved in properly riding a horse. It will make you laugh, gasp, and leave you scratching your head in bewilderment. By the end of this memoir, you will understand why I absolutely believe... ""From my saddle life is a great adventure."""
